
Isoromiderm gel 30 g
Tradename
Isoromiderm
Isoromyderm
Composition
Each 100 grams of gel contains:
Isotretinoin 0.05 g
Erythromycin 2 g
Auxiliary components:
Hypromellose, propylene glycol, ethanol
99.9%.
Properties
Antimicrobial agent for topical use. Isotretinoin is one of the biologically active forms of vitamin A, it has antiseborrheic, antiinflammatory and keratolytic effects. It has a stimulating effect on the growth of epithelial cells and their differentiation. It inhibits the terminal differentiation of sebocytes and hyperproliferation of the epithelium of the excretory ducts of the sebaceous glands, normalizes the composition of their secretion and facilitates its excretion, reduces the production of sebum and reduces the inflammatory reaction around the sebaceous glands. Indications
Mild to moderate acne.
Method of administration and dosage:
Outwardly, for adults and adolescents from 12 years old: the drug is applied in a thin layer on the affected skin area 2 times a day: in the morning (before applying makeup) and in the evening (after washing). The course of treatment is 6—8 weeks.
Contraindications
Hypersensitivity, pregnancy, lactation, children under 12 years of age (efficacy and safety of use have not been established).
Precautions:
Avoid contact of the drug with the mucous membranes of the mouth, nose and eyes, as well as with damaged or ulcerated skin surface. Care should be taken when applying the product to sensitive skin areas such as around the eyes and neck.
Side effects
Local reactions: paresthesias, burning and skin irritation; hyperemia and peeling of the skin; photosensitivity.
Storage method:
At a temperature not higher than 25 degrees.
